Developing A International Search Engine Optimization Approach & Optimal Techniques

Successfully engaging a global audience requires more than just translation; it demands a carefully considered international SEO plan. This involves analyzing how search engines including Google function in different countries. Important guidelines include conducting thorough keyword investigation in various languages, enhancing your website's structure for international search, and carefully organizing hreflang tags to accurately indicate search engines which version of a page is intended for particular countries. Furthermore, fostering local link networks and modifying content to local nuances is critically vital for gaining sustainable international visibility and producing relevant visitors to your website.

### Connecting With Worldwide Viewers

p Reaching a wider customer base requires more than just a great website; it demands thoughtful optimization for global audiences. Consider several key areas to truly resonate with people from different cultures and languages. Firstly, accurate and professional translation – or even better, transcreation – is essential to ensure your message isn't lost in translation. Secondly, think about localizing your content, which includes adapting everything from currency and dates to imagery and tone. Thirdly, optimize your website’s structure and metadata for search engines in various regions – remembering that search behavior differs significantly across the globe. Finally, evaluate your website's performance using tools that support multiple languages and regions to gain valuable insights into user experience. By focusing on these elements, you can transform your website into a powerful tool for international growth.

Advanced Global Search Engine Optimization: Accessibility & Cataloging

Proper technical worldwide SEO hinges significantly on ensuring your site is fully crawlable and listed by search engines. First, spiders must be able to discover your pages and effectively interpret their material. This involves optimizing your website structure, creating a clear site map, and diligently checking your robots.txt configuration. Furthermore, confirming that your site are accurately indexed is nearly important. Insufficient indexing can result in your important material being overlooked in online visibility. Regularly assessing your site’s accessibility and indexing using utilities like Google’s Search Console is vital for preserving optimal visibility.
